The OTP Login With Phone Number, OTP Verification plugin for WordPress is vulnerable to authentication bypass in versions 1.8.50 through 1.8.60. This is due to the Firebase verification flow in the `lwp_ajax_register` AJAX handler not binding the Firebase session to the phone number supplied in the request. The `idehweb_lwp_activate_through_firebase()` function validates that a Firebase OTP session is legitimate, but the `phoneNumber` returned by Firebase is never compared against the victim's stored phone number. This makes it possible for unauthenticated attackers to authenticate as any user who has a phone number stored in user meta, including administrators, by verifying their own Firebase session and supplying the victim's phone number in the same request.

pypdf has a possible infinite loop when loading circular /Prev entries in cross-reference streams
### Impact
An attacker who uses this vulnerability can craft a PDF which leads to an infinite loop. This requires reading the file.
### Patches
This has been fixed in [pypdf==6.7.2](https://github.com/py-pdf/pypdf/releases/tag/6.7.2).
### Workarounds
If users cannot upgrade yet, consider applying the changes from PR [#3655](https://github.com/py-pdf/pypdf/pull/3655).
